Getting back on track

5/10/2022

0 Comments

 
It’s hard to remember our lives before they shut down due to the pandemic. We were abruptly put on hold and we all had to make adjustments to what we knew as ‘normal’. We suffered, endured, and as humanity always does, we persisted and found a way to adapt. During the pandemic, we heard the phrase the ‘New Normal’, not knowing what it truly meant. Well, we are living it in our current lives. The pandemic feels like a distant memory, a brief pause to find new ways to live. As we always say at UKSD, every adversity is an opportunity to create something better and stronger and if we are not part of the solution, then we are part of the problem.

Here in the U.S., we are lucky enough to be pretty much back to where we were before the pandemic. We must be grateful however, for the opportunities that Covid presented us. Our everyday work through UKSD has always remained the same, before, during, and after Covid. We strive to create opportunities for young people too better their lives, become positive active citizens, and create a better world to live in. The pandemic allowed us to take a step back and develop new and improved ways to accomplish this.

Due to this opportunity, we have been able to develop new strategies and initiatives that have actually increased our impact both locally and overseas. The bread and butter of our program has been our KidzPlay4FreeProject. Recently, we have enhanced this initiative to not only provide free of charge sports programming to young people as  way to develop life skills and raise awareness about social issues. We are now working more closely with schools to help build peer to peer connections across all grades form K-12 while helping to advance educational literacy skills, within the youth we work with. Our active citizenship initiatives have grown beyond anything that we could have ever imagined. Due to the new virtual world, we have been able to develop strong realtionships with like minded organizations across the globe. These programs have helped to create projects that have created a deeper understanding of other cultures while collaborating on projects that have literally changed lives and bettered some of the most poverty stricken communities on the planet. Due to this, we have revamped our programming slightly and created two new initiatives, Projects Through Play and the Sustainability Project. ​

The PTP initiative has allowed us to use our experiences from the previous decade and develop an initiative that uses what we have learned, to help encourage others to use their platform, whether educator, leader, or student, to create their own change. We have been fortunate enough to have had the opportunity to immerse ourselves within the Barnstable Public School system to run professional development for teachers, create student dropout prevention and engagement initiatives, and work alongside educational professionals to help develop programming that aligns with the mainstream educational system. We call this way of learning Experiential Education. This style of learning allows participants to use a blend of purposeful play and project based learning to create positive civic action. So far, all involved have expressed how this style of learning has created a deeper level of understanding and developed more social awareness about the challenges that we all face.

The sustainability project was born out of the demand from our alums. Former high school UKSD members who have moved on to their adult lives were eager to find ways to continue the work that had guided them through their own teenage years. After a few discussions, we were left with little doubt to create something that would give them the platform to do so. Members of the this initiative are known as UKSD Ambassadors. Although there is still a small level of facilitation to help guide and connect them to the UKSD network, these ambassadors are working together to develop new initiatives that they are personally devoted too. It is our hope that these individuals will use the UKSD platform to create their own projects and initiatives that they can be passionate about for the rest of their lives.
Although recent times have been difficult, we believe that we have used this adversity to find solutions. The way that life is, we know that there will be other times of adversity  ahead and when they arise, we will buckle up our boot straps and keep moving forwards. For now though, we are excited for the next chapter of our journey….
